>Hi Andrea,
>If I understand correctly, you want your linestrings to carry an
>attribute telling if the polygons they come from is clockwise or
>counter clockwise ?
>
>You could compare the original polygons and the reversed version, to
>determine their orientation:
>
>select st_orderingEquals(geom, st_forceRHR(geom)) from
>
>(select geometryFromText('POLYGON ((0 0, 1 0, 1 1, 0 1, 0 0))', -1) as geom
>union
>select geometryFromText('POLYGON ((2 2, 2 3, 3 3, 3 2, 2 2))', -1) as
>geom) as foo
>;
>
>If you keep a link between linestrings and polygons they come from, an
>update to the linestrings table should be easy, then.
